What Is Climate-Controlled Storage?

While you might think all storage units are the same, climate-controlled storage offers distinct advantages. By choosing this option, you benefit from temperature regulation and humidity control, guaranteeing that your items remain in prime condition.

Unlike standard storage units, climate-controlled units maintain a consistent temperature range, protecting your belongings from extreme heat or cold. This is essential for items sensitive to temperature fluctuations, such as electronics or wooden furniture.

Additionally, humidity control helps prevent dampness, which can lead to mold, mildew, and warping. This feature is particularly important if you’re storing delicate items like documents, photographs, or antiques.

How Does Climate Control Protect Your Belongings?

Choosing climate-controlled storage isn’t just about maintaining a steady environment; it’s about actively protecting your valuable possessions from potential damage.

Humidity control guarantees that moisture levels stay ideal, preventing mold and mildew from wreaking havoc on your belongings. Excess humidity can warp wood, rust metals, or ruin fabrics. On the flip side, too little moisture can dry out and crack leather or wood.

Temperature regulation is equally vital. Extreme temperatures can cause expansion and contraction in materials, leading to cracks, warping, or brittleness.

Protecting Wooden Furniture

While wooden furniture adds warmth and elegance to any space, it’s also susceptible to environmental changes that can cause damage over time.

Climate-controlled storage in Homewood helps you protect your cherished pieces by maintaining consistent temperature and humidity levels. Without proper humidity control, wood can warp, crack, or even develop mold.

To guarantee your furniture’s longevity, consider these wood preservation techniques:

  • Consistent Humidity Levels: Prevent expansion and contraction by keeping humidity stable.
  • Temperature Regulation: Avoid warping by maintaining a steady temperature.
  • Ventilation: Allow air circulation to prevent moisture buildup.
  • Protective Covers: Shield surfaces from dust and dirt.

Understanding Costs of Climate-Controlled Units

When considering climate-controlled storage in Homewood, it’s essential to understand the costs involved so you can make an informed decision.

Climate-controlled units often come with higher price tags than traditional options, but knowing the cost breakdown helps you weigh the benefits.

Here’s what you should consider regarding unit pricing:

  • Size of the Unit: Larger spaces naturally cost more. Assess your storage needs to avoid paying for unused space.

  • Location within the Facility: Units on upper floors or at the back might be cheaper than ground-level or front-access ones.

  • Duration of Rental: Long-term commitments might offer discounted pricing, reducing monthly costs.

  • Special Features: Additional amenities like around-the-clock access or advanced climate settings can increase your overall expenditure.

Evaluate these factors to maximize value.

Packing Tips for Climate-Controlled Units

Packing your belongings for climate-controlled storage requires a few strategic steps to guarantee everything stays in pristine condition.

Start by selecting the right packing materials, such as sturdy boxes and bubble wrap, to protect fragile items. Consider using plastic bins for added durability and moisture resistance.

When thinking about storage organization, label each box clearly, making retrieval a breeze later on. Stack heavier boxes at the bottom and lighter ones on top to prevent damage.

Optimize space and accessibility with these tips:

  • Use wardrobe boxes for clothing, keeping them fresh and wrinkle-free.
  • Wrap electronics in anti-static materials to prevent dust accumulation.
  • Store documents in airtight containers to avoid moisture damage.
  • Layer books with acid-free paper to maintain their condition.

These steps guarantee your items remain safe and sound.

What Is the Average Temperature in Climate-Controlled Units?

In climate-controlled storage units, you’ll typically find an average climate maintained between 55°F and 80°F.

This temperature range guarantees your belongings aren’t exposed to extreme heat or cold, protecting sensitive items like electronics, antiques, and documents.

By keeping a consistent environment, these units help prevent damage from humidity and temperature fluctuations.
